60-20-04 LOCKHEED: Amdt. 203 Part 507 Federal Register September 28, 1960. Applies to 188 Aircraft Serial Numbers 1002, 1004 Through 1102, 1104 Through 1126, and 2001 Through 2015.

Compliance required by the next 300 hours' time in service after October 28, 1960.

Leaking lavatory tank ground drain valves have permitted drainage to the exterior surface of the aircraft in flight, resulting in ice formation which came off and struck the stabilizer. Since such ice formation is hazardous to aircraft in flight and to persons on the ground, all lavatory tank ground drain valves must be modified to incorporate LAC seal No. 838228-1 or equivalent. (LAC 88/SB-407 covers the intent of this change.)

This directive effective October 28, 1960.
